Mona Lisa might be her most famous paintings in the world. The masterpiece created by Leonardo da Vinci is often the main attraction for those visiting the Louvre Museum in Paris.
On Sunday afternoon, a man dressed as a wheelchair-bound elderly lady rushed towards the painting and smeared cake on the protective bulletproof glass covering it. Then he threw roses on the ground.
But even as he was being escorted by museum security, the man addressed the people recording him, reportedly stressing the importance of protecting the environment.

This is not the first time mona lisa faced the wrath of museum visitors. As reported by The guardIn 2009, a Russian woman allegedly frustrated that she had not been granted French citizenship threw a ceramic mug at the woman mona lisa. Fortunately, the painting was protected by bulletproof glass at the time.
